Trafford Parks Tennis Coach
This is an exciting part-time tennis coaching role delivering across our parks venues in
Trafford. Starting with a core block of group delivery, the role offers the opportunity to build
additional hours of individual coaching as the programme grows.
On-court delivery consists of LTA Youth through to Adult group sessions on a weekly basis
— a mixture of established sessions and new sessions you will help develop. As the
programme expands, there is real scope to grow your hours.
The successful candidate will deliver high-quality group coaching and can run a self employed coaching business alongside the programme.
Key Responsibilities:
• On-court delivery: deliver tennis coaching across LTA Youth Start, Tennis Express,
Adult sessions and Cardio Tennis.
• Develop school and club links to help grow the coaching programme.
• Build your own private lesson base: develop and run individual coaching on a selfemployed basis alongside the group programme.
Hours & Compensation:
• Part-time role, starting with a core block of group delivery plus the opportunity to add
hours as the programme grows.
• Group delivery typically £16–£25 per hour, dependent on qualifications and
experience.
• Build your own private lesson base, typically £35+ per hour, with 100% of selfemployed individual coaching income retained.
• Additional income available from school outreach and camps.
• Both employed and self-employed arrangements are available.

Trafford Parks is part of National Tennis's parks tennis partnerships, bringing affordable, well-organised tennis to the local community across park venues in Trafford, Greater Manchester. We offer expert organisation and a welcoming, inclusive environment for players of all ages and abilities.
National Tennis is a Community Interest Company and one of the UK's largest tennis coaching organisations, with over 100 employed coaches delivering across the country. We offer high-quality, affordable tennis across a portfolio of parks, clubs and indoor centres.
